COTABATO CITY — The Ministry of Basic, Higher and Technical Education in the Bangsamoro Autonomous Region in Muslim Mindanao (BARRM) recognized on Monday its winning athletes from the recently-concluded Palarong Pambansa by extending cash rewards for the honor they have brought to the region.

The BARMM bagged a total of 19 medals – three golds, ten silvers, and six bronzes – from the April 27-May 4 Palarong Pambansa 2019 games in Davao City.

Cash rewards of PHP20,000 were given to each of the gold medalists, PHP15,000 for silver, and PHP10,000 to the bronze winners.

BARMM Education Minister Mohagher Iqbal–together with BARMM Assistant Executive Secretary Abdullah Cusain, and Director Taya Aplal of the region’s Bureau of Physical Education and Special Events–led the awarding ceremony held at the Shariff Kabunsuan Complex, the seat of the BARMM government situated in this city.

“You have fought a great fight; you have surpassed the expectations,” Iqbal told the athletes.

BARMM ranked 16th among the 17 regions in the country who joined this year’s national games.

Iqbal said that in 2017, the region has been in the bottom rank of the annual Palaro with only a total of 9 medals.

In 2018, the region only won a total of three bronze medals from the annual multi-sport event involving student-athletes from 17 regions of the country.

“This year (2019), however, you have brought home an amazing 19 medals,” Iqbal said.

BARMM athletes won gold medals in athletics long jump, athletics triple jump, and lawn tennis doubles event, all in the elementary level.

BARMM players also garnered silver medals in the high jump, billiards 9-ball competition, lawn tennis, and taekwondo events. The region also collected bronze medals in the boxing, table tennis, football and taekwondo (elementary and secondary) events.

In addition, BARMM also acquired medals in the demo sports (arnis and pencak silat) and Paralympics special events.
